Understanding the Essence of Hospital Management Software
Hospital management software is a comprehensive solution designed to automate and streamline the various facets of hospital operations. From patient records and appointment scheduling to billing and inventory management, this software integrates diverse functions into a unified platform. Its primary goal is to enhance operational efficiency, reduce manual errors, and provide healthcare professionals with the tools they need for effective decision-making.
Key Features of Hospital Management Software
Patient Information Management: One of the core functionalities is the seamless management of patient information. This includes recording and retrieving patient details, medical history, and treatment plans in a secure and organized manner.
Appointment Scheduling: The software facilitates hassle-free appointment scheduling, ensuring that both patients and healthcare providers can manage their time effectively.
Billing and Invoicing: Automation of billing processes minimizes errors, accelerates the billing cycle, and enhances financial transparency for both the healthcare institution and the patient.
Inventory and Supply Chain Management: Efficient management of medical supplies and inventory is critical for uninterrupted healthcare services. Hospital management software optimizes these processes, preventing shortages or excesses.
Integration of Electronic Health Records (EHR): Seamless integration of EHR ensures that healthcare professionals have instant access to a patient's medical history, enabling informed decision-making and personalized care.

Choosing the Right Hospital Management Software
Considerations for Selection
Scalability: Opt for software that can scale with the growth of your healthcare institution, accommodating increased data and user loads.
User-Friendly Interface: Intuitive design and ease of use are paramount for seamless adoption across all levels of healthcare staff.
Security Measures: Given the sensitive nature of healthcare data, robust security features, including encryption and access controls, are non-negotiable.
Interoperability: Ensure that the software can integrate seamlessly with existing systems and third-party applications for a cohesive healthcare ecosystem.
